As data demand rises endlessly in the world, continuing exponential growth of data generation, transfer, collection, analysis, and storage is driving and shaping optical communication networks in different ways. The two most notable advances have been wavelength division multiplexing (WDM) and coherent communications, which again continue to evolve and are being combined to create even more advanced networks such as super-channel and flex-grid architectures. Semiconductor diode lasers, as light sources of these systems, must meet an ever more demanding and diverse set of technical specifications. For example, some of the new transmission schemes also require that the wavelength channels are mutually coherent, or locked together in phase.
